React testing library mock custom hook

WebDeclare the hook as a prop, but default it to the real hook so you don't have to set it everywhere you render the component, but allow overriding with a mock for tests. Here is … WebSelf-employed. Jan 2024 - Present1 year 3 months. - Work with product owners and stock holders to discuss full technical and business requirement. - Implement Cypress, Jest, and Enzyme testing ...

How to mock custom React Hooks with Jest - DevDecks

Web1 day ago · How do you test for the non-existence of an element using jest and react-testing-library? 484 React Hook Warnings for async function in useEffect: useEffect function must return a cleanup function or nothing WebMar 28, 2024 · react-testing-library · testing React Hook Form has emerged as a popular and efficient library for managing form state and validation in React applications. It simplifies handling form inputs, reduces boilerplate … hide and seek towing and recovery https://gpstechnologysolutions.com

How to Unit Test a Custom React Hooks ⚓ by Ivan Ha

WebJun 30, 2024 · Durante los últimos años se han introducido cambios significativos en el ecosistema de React, como la llegada de los hooks o la adopción de React Testing Librarycomo nuevo standard para tests. Esto hace necesario nuevos métodos para testear las aplicaciones y conseguir una buena cobertura. WebMar 8, 2024 · React Hooks Testing Library is a set of utilities that, as the name suggests, lets you test your custom hooks. You don’t have to create components to test your hook, nor to figure out how to trigger all the cases in which it could be updated. It’s a hassle-free way of testing even more advanced and complex hooks. WebThis could happen for one of the following reasons: 1. You might have mismatching versions of React and the renderer (such as React DOM) 2. You might be breaking the Rules of … hide and seek summary

Branch details - Prince George

Category:How to use react-testing-library and jest with …

Tags:React testing library mock custom hook

React testing library mock custom hook

How to test custom React hooks - Kent C. Dodds

WebMar 16, 2024 · In the test file I had to mock the import from lib/hooks, in this case the custom hooks from my /lib folder. In order to mock an import you need to call on the mock function from the jest object and then return an object that matches the exports. In the below example an object is returned containing the exported usePageClass as a mock … WebDec 5, 2024 · モック化の方法はいくつかあるようですが今回はtestコードの中でモック化しています。 手順は以下の通りです。 1. テストコードでモックしたいモジュールをimportする 2. jest.mock でモジュールをモック化する 3. mockImplementation () でモック化したモジュールが何を返すか実装する 4. mockClear () でテスト完了時に呼び出された回数など …

React testing library mock custom hook

Did you know?

WebIn this article, we will see how we can test this hook, first using no test libraries (only React Test Utilities and Jest) and then by using react-hooks-testing-library. The motivation …

W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features NFL Sunday Ticket Press Copyright ... WebFeb 25, 2024 · React hooks let you use state and other react features without writing a class. One of the big benefits of using hooks is that they let you reuse the logic of your components in a much cleaner...

How to use react-testing-library and jest with mocked custom react hook updating? Look at the following custom hook. The premise is that it updates its state when query changes. export function UseCustomHook () { const { query } = useRouter () const [state, setState] = useState ( {}) useEffect ( () => { const updatedState = helperFunction ... WebJun 11, 2024 · Testing React: Components, Containers and Custom Hooks. by Alex Shepherd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s...

WebFeb 6, 2024 · Custom testHook: EDIT: see that uses the correct API for testHook Custom : If the provider doesn't require the ability to change the value: If the wrapper needs to accept props: (() (): ) a) . alexkrolick mentioned this issue on Feb 11, 2024 Add wrapper option to render/testHook #293 Closed 2 tasks danielkcz mentioned this issue on Feb 12, 2024

Web- Writing unit tests using TDD, Jest and React-testing-library. - Creating mock functions, contexts, and custom hooks. - Creating Browser Widgets using Javascript, HTML, CSS and WebPack. - Adding WebPack plugins. - Agile: Scrum - Creating a puppeteer.js node server to scrape dynamic websites. - Using node to create a JSON file and populate it. hide and seek towing augusta gaWebcypress-react-unit-test > A little helper to unit test React components in the open source Cypress.io E2E test runner v4.5.0+. Jump to: Comparison, Blog posts, Presentations, Install, Examples: basic, advanced, full, external, Mocking, Style options, Code coverage, Visual testing, Common problems, Chat Survey. Hi there! We are trying to collect feedback from … hide and seek the movie 2019WebThe react-hooks-testing-library allows you to create a simple test harness for React hooks that handles running them within the body of a function component, as well as providing … howell smith obituaryJul 1, 2024 · howells mill wvWebYou can also find React Testing Library examples at react-testing-examples.com. Hooks. If you are interested in testing a custom hook, check out [React Hooks Testing … hide and seek the movie smlWebDec 9, 2024 · Testing custom React Hooks To test the custom hook useTheFetch two more dependencies will need to be installed. @testing-library/react-hooks is a helpful utility to … hide and seek trailer among usWebApr 11, 2024 · A custom hook is a JavaScript function that utilizes React hooks, such as useState and useEffect, to manage and share stateful logic between components. Example: Creating a custom hook for email ... hide and seek toys for cats